Web10 apr. 2024 · The IRS recommends that individuals calculate the estimated tax liability amount for the entire year, divide that amount by four and send in payments according to the schedule. There is a worksheet with the Form 1040-ES package or as part of the tax software package such as Turbo Tax. Web12 apr. 2024 · IR-2024-78, April 12, 2024. WASHINGTON — The Internal Revenue Service today reminded people that Tax Day, April 18, is also the deadline for first quarter estimated tax payments for tax year 2024.
